import pytest
from app.notifications.validators import check_service_message_limit, check_template_is_for_notification_type, \
check_template_is_active, service_can_send_to_recipient, check_sms_content_char_count
from app.v2.errors import BadRequestError, TooManyRequestsError
from tests.app.conftest import (sample_notification as create_notification,
sample_service as create_service, sample_service_whitelist)
@pytest.mark.parametrize('key_type', ['test', 'team', 'normal'])
def test_check_service_message_limit_with_unrestricted_service_passes(key_type,
sample_service,
sample_notification):
assert check_service_message_limit(key_type, sample_service) is None
@pytest.mark.parametrize('key_type', ['test', 'team', 'normal'])
def test_check_service_message_limit_under_message_limit_passes(key_type,
sample_service,
sample_notification):
assert check_service_message_limit(key_type, sample_service) is None
@pytest.mark.parametrize('key_type', ['team', 'normal'])
def test_check_service_message_limit_over_message_limit_fails(key_type, notify_db, notify_db_session):
service = create_service(notify_db, notify_db_session, restricted=True, limit=4)
for x in range(5):
create_notification(notify_db, notify_db_session, service=service)
with pytest.raises(TooManyRequestsError):
check_service_message_limit(key_type, service)
@pytest.mark.parametrize('template_type, notification_type',
[('email', 'email'),
('sms', 'sms')])
def test_check_template_is_for_notification_type_pass(template_type, notification_type):
assert check_template_is_for_notification_type(notification_type=notification_type,
template_type=template_type) is None
@pytest.mark.parametrize('template_type, notification_type',
[('sms', 'email'),
('email', 'sms')])
def test_check_template_is_for_notification_type_fails_when_template_type_does_not_match_notification_type(
template_type, notification_type):
with pytest.raises(BadRequestError):
check_template_is_for_notification_type(notification_type=notification_type,
template_type=template_type)
def test_check_template_is_active_passes(sample_template):
assert check_template_is_active(sample_template) is None
def test_check_template_is_active_fails(sample_template):
sample_template.archived = True
from app.dao.templates_dao import dao_update_template
dao_update_template(sample_template)
try:
check_template_is_active(sample_template)
except BadRequestError as e:
assert e.status_code == 400
assert e.code == '10400'
assert e.message == 'Template has been deleted'
assert e.link == "link to documentation"
@pytest.mark.parametrize('key_type',
['test', 'normal'])
def test_service_can_send_to_recipient_passes(key_type, notify_db, notify_db_session):
trial_mode_service = create_service(notify_db, notify_db_session, service_name='trial mode', restricted=True)
assert service_can_send_to_recipient(trial_mode_service.users[0].email_address,
key_type,
trial_mode_service) is None
assert service_can_send_to_recipient(trial_mode_service.users[0].mobile_number,
key_type,
trial_mode_service) is None
@pytest.mark.parametrize('key_type',
['test', 'normal'])
def test_service_can_send_to_recipient_passes_for_live_service_non_team_member(key_type, notify_db, notify_db_session):
live_service = create_service(notify_db, notify_db_session, service_name='live', restricted=False)
assert service_can_send_to_recipient("some_other_email@test.com",
key_type,
live_service) is None
assert service_can_send_to_recipient('07513332413',
key_type,
live_service) is None
@pytest.mark.parametrize('key_type',
['team'])
def test_service_can_send_to_recipient_passes_for_whitelisted_recipient_passes(key_type, notify_db, notify_db_session,
sample_service):
sample_service_whitelist(notify_db, notify_db_session, email_address="some_other_email@test.com")
assert service_can_send_to_recipient("some_other_email@test.com",
key_type,
sample_service) is None
sample_service_whitelist(notify_db, notify_db_session, mobile_number='07513332413')
assert service_can_send_to_recipient('07513332413',
key_type,
sample_service) is None
@pytest.mark.parametrize('key_type',
['team', 'normal'])
def test_service_can_send_to_recipient_fails_when_recipient_is_not_on_team(key_type, notify_db, notify_db_session):
trial_mode_service = create_service(notify_db, notify_db_session, service_name='trial mode', restricted=True)
with pytest.raises(BadRequestError):
assert service_can_send_to_recipient("some_other_email@test.com",
key_type,
trial_mode_service) is None
with pytest.raises(BadRequestError):
assert service_can_send_to_recipient('07513332413',
key_type,
trial_mode_service) is None
def test_service_can_send_to_recipient_fails_when_mobile_number_is_not_on_team(notify_db, notify_db_session):
live_service = create_service(notify_db, notify_db_session, service_name='live mode', restricted=False)
with pytest.raises(BadRequestError):
assert service_can_send_to_recipient("0758964221",
'team',
live_service) is None
@pytest.mark.parametrize('char_count', [495, 0, 494, 200])
def test_check_sms_content_char_count_passes(char_count, notify_api):
assert check_sms_content_char_count(char_count) is None
@pytest.mark.parametrize('char_count', [496, 500, 6000])
def test_check_sms_content_char_count_fails(char_count, notify_api):
with pytest.raises(BadRequestError):
check_sms_content_char_count(char_count)
